LJ-2698 is an orally active antagonist of the adenosine A3 receptor. This compound demonstrates significant anti-inflammatory effects by increasing levels of anti-inflammatory cytokines and promoting the proliferation of M2 macrophages in lung tissues, leading to improved pulmonary function and reduced alveolar cavity enlargement. Additionally, LJ-2698 has shown potential in preventing renal injury associated with diabetic nephropathy by inhibiting lipid accumulation and enhancing PGC1α expression in renal tissues. This reagent is suitable for research applications related to emphysema and diabetic nephropathy.
